Parallel Quest is a podcast that talks about the stories we love and shares our personal stories of how they have impacted our lives. The discussions cover all sorts of stories from a variety of different media forms such as books, movies, and video games. Put on your nostalgia goggles and join the journey of Parallel Quest. Cody and Zach have been close friends since high school, who love stories and the craft of storytelling. Parallel Quest is their journey in sharing personal stories from the first, fifth, or 100th time they have absorbed a particular story. Rather than a traditional "review" of the variety of different stories and their media formats, Parallel Quest focuses to discuss "how it is remembered" instead of "why it is good."

    In the mid-late 90's something that was on the minds of many was whether or not our planet and civilization was going to make it into the next millennium. With that came an increasing popularity in disaster films. What better plot line than to have the entire human race threatened by Alien invaders, whose sole purpose is to destroy humanity as we knew it. However, these aliens would run into the stopping power of the United States Air Force and their uncanny ability to string together a plan to save the planet in a mere 48 hours. Not only is it the most efficient use of government time and resources imaginable, all of this is accomplished on the very day that the United States forefathers decided to declare their independence from the rule of Great Britain, hence the title INDEPENDENCE DAY.     In 2000, the new Millennia brought one of the teams favorite movies, Ridley Scott's Gladiator, starring Russel Crowe. Growing up this was an important movie in the lives of our teenage selves, from the great battle scenes to the script full of one-liners. Even though the final product is something that the guys love, that doesn't mean the production was without its fair share of hiccups. The script full of quotable lines was anything but easy to work with. The relationship with Proximo (Oliver Reed) and Maximus (Russel Crowe) on screen was somewhat reflective of the difficult relationship that these two had off-screen.
